AerodynamicsPressure & Flow $e%initions and Measurement
Fan Flow Rate
• Often called inlet volume
• Measured at the fan inlet, by convention
• Measured in cubic feet per minute (cfm)
• May be converted to scfm (standard cubic feet per minute), or mass flow (lb/hr)
• an manufacturers commonly use acfm (actual cubic feet per minute)

AerodynamicsPressure & Flow $e%initions and Measurement
Static Pressure
• #ressure due to degree of compression and density only
• May be positive or negative
(elocity Pressure
• #ressure due to rate of motion and density only• Always positive
3otal Pressure
• Algebraic sum of static and velocity pressures at a point• May be positive or negative
